Election 2024: Climate — 'Lack of flood defences is holding Blackpool back'

Businesses tell the Irish Examiner that the €20m flood relief scheme for the area is a critical requirement

Torrential rain in Blackpool, Cork, in 2022 saw Cork City Council crews clearing drains and gullies. Picture: Andy Gibson.

It’s been years in the making, but another Government has come and gone without a breakthrough for the people of Blackpool in Cork city on their long-awaited flood relief scheme.

“We’re disappointed to say the least,” said Jer Buckley, who runs The Pantry in the north city suburb. “There’s been no proper delivery of the Blackpool flood scheme for the Blackpool people.
